New England vs Los Angeles had fans and pundits alike scrambling for the record books for all the wrong reasons.

The Patriots took on the Rams in Super Bowl 53 in Atlanta in a battle of two of the best offenses in the NFL.

But it was defences who dominated for much of the contest with the Pats only leading 3-0 at half-time.

The lowest scoring Super Bowl was Super Bowl 7.

The Miami Dolphins defeated the Washington Redskins in game where only 21 total points were scored. The Phins eventually prevailed 14-7.

Only three touchdowns and three extra points were scored in the 1973 encounter.
